VIRGIN ISLANDS – VITRAN’s ADA paratransit clients on St. Thomas and St. John can now join those on St. Croix, in utilizing Routematch, the department’s new trip management technology platform. Routematch launched in the St. Thomas/St. John district earlier this month and on St. Croix in June of this year.
VIRGIN ISLANDS – The Department of Public Works is advising the public, that while VITRAN’s Fixed Route service remains suspended, residents will notice buses on roadways starting August 31. The buses will be used for Mass Transit Bus Operator training purposes only and will continue until September 4. VITRAN will continue to provide ADA Paratransit services to passengers traveling for dialysis and medical care.
VIRGIN ISLANDS – The U.S. Department of Transportation allocated $4.1 million dollars for the Department of Public Works and VITRAN to prevent, prepare for and respond to COVID-19. The Coronavirus Aid, Relief and Economic Security (CARES) Act was signed into law on March 27, 2020 and contains $25 billion for transit agencies throughout the United States to fund operating costs and lost revenue.

VIRGIN ISLANDS – The Department of Public Works and VITRAN announces the expansion of ADA-Paratransit services for certified passengers. Effective Tuesday, May 26, VITRAN will provide services one day per week for non-medical trips such as grocery shopping, banking, and other locations. Certified passengers must make reservations by calling VITRAN at (340) 773-1664 on St. Croix; (340) 774-5678 on St. Thomas; and (340) 626-4010 on St. John.
As a result of the COVID-19 Pandemic, passengers are asked to always wear masks while traveling on the bus.
